CCRHL ID: 615321
220
GPGP
141
GGoals
217
358
PTSPoints
1.63
P/GPP/GP
Grand Trunk Arena
Knights of Columbus
Castledowns
Canadian Athletic Club
Kinsmen
| Date | Matchup | Team | Pos | G | A | PTS | PIM | |
|---|---|---|---|---|---|---|---|---|
| Mar 13, 2026 | Vikes vs Glizzies | Vikes | P | 0 | 1 | 1 | 0 | |
| Mar 6, 2026 | Muskrats vs Vikes | Vikes | P | 0 | 0 | 0 | 0 | |
| Feb 27, 2026 | Vikes vs Moonshiners | Vikes | P | 0 | 0 | 0 | 0 | |
| Feb 15, 2026 | Bens Friends vs Outlaws | Outlaws | P | 0 | 0 | 0 | 0 | |
| Feb 14, 2026 | Dusters vs Outlaws | Outlaws | P | 1 | 0 | 1 | 0 | |
| Feb 14, 2026 | Outlaws vs La Bamba's | Outlaws | P | 0 | 0 | 0 | 0 | |
| Feb 13, 2026 | Bens Friends vs Outlaws | Outlaws | P | 0 | 0 | 0 | 2 |
Vikes vs Glizzies
Muskrats vs Vikes
Vikes vs Moonshiners
Bens Friends vs Outlaws
Dusters vs Outlaws
Outlaws vs La Bamba's
Bens Friends vs Outlaws
229 GP — 350 PTS — 1.53 P/GP
57pts
19G 38A in 27 GP
Vikes · Winter 21/22
20
7
| Season | Team | Div | GP | G | A | P | P/GP | PIM | PPG | SHG | GWG | OTG | SOG |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Winter 2025/20262 teams | 2 teams | - | 22 | 4 | 17 | 21 | 0.95 | 4 | 0 | 0 | 2 | 0 | 0 |
| Summer 2025 | Outlaws | Division 6 | 10 | 5 | 19 | 24 | 2.40 | 14 | 0 | 0 | 0 | 0 | 0 |
| Winter 2024/20252 teams | 2 teams | - | 13 | 9 | 8 | 17 | 1.31 | 6 | 0 | 0 | 0 | 0 | 0 |
| Summer 2024 | Outlaws | Division 7 | 9 | 8 | 17 | 25 | 2.78 | 6 | 0 | 0 | 0 | 0 | 0 |
| Winter 2023/20243 teams | 3 teams | - | 19 | 8 | 16 | 24 | 1.26 | 12 | 0 | 0 | 0 | 0 | 0 |
| Summer 2023 | Ghostriders | Division 7 | 12 | 12 | 14 | 26 | 2.17 | 8 | 0 | 0 | 2 | 0 | 0 |
| Winter 22/23 | Vikes | Division 5 | 26 | 21 | 12 | 33 | 1.27 | 14 | 2 | 0 | 0 | 0 | 0 |
| Winter 21/22 | Vikes | Division 5 | 27 | 19 | 38 | 57 | 2.11 | 30 | 2 | 0 | 2 | 0 | 0 |
| Winter 2019/2020 | Vikes | Div 4 | 25 | 19 | 27 | 46 | 1.84 | 16 | 1 | 0 | 0 | 0 | 0 |
| Winter 2018/2019 | Vikes | Div 4 | 25 | 16 | 28 | 44 | 1.76 | 22 | 1 | 0 | 2 | 0 | 0 |
| Summer 2018 | Rage | Div 5 | 7 | 5 | 4 | 9 | 1.29 | 8 | 0 | 0 | 0 | 0 | 0 |
| Winter 2017/2018 | Vikes | Div 4 | 25 | 15 | 17 | 32 | 1.28 | 26 | 3 | 0 | 1 | 0 | 0 |
| Career Totals | 220 | 141 | 217 | 358 | 1.63 | 166 | 9 | 0 | 9 | 0 | 0 | ||
Career Totals
Mike is a creative playmaker who drives offense through assists, producing at a steady, reliable clip. A 220-game veteran with 358 career points. Sits inside the top 200 in career points.
Establishing consistency
Cementing legacy
Carried a team on their back
Other
Backpack
Led team in points on a losing squad